 College Motto

The words of the College crest are "Gratias Agamus" ( ‘Let us give thanks’) and echo the gracious obedience to the Divine Will characterised primarily by Our Lady and also by St Patrick in his writings. They challenge us to bring our pupils to an understanding of the world as God’s creation and of the sacredness of life; and to an appreciation of their vocation in Christ and how to fulfill that vocation. As a school community we grow in Christ through a combination of prayer, sacramental and non-sacramental worship and the development of the strength of character to live the Christian life.
